Matthew Sweet, old & new

WE'VE BEEN WAITING: Nirvana’s Nevermind wasn’t the only hugely influential album to see the light of day in the fall of 1991. The bone-dry, caterwauling sonics of Matthew Sweet’s Girlfriend opened up a wild and picturesque new terrain for restless singer/songwriters to inhabit and explore, while also pretty much reinventing power pop—and it was loaded with memorable songs, starting with the title cut, “I’ve Been Waiting” and “Divine Intervention.” (If you don’t believe it, just ask Karen Glauber or Bud Scoppa.) Next month, Sweet will play his much-beloved LP from top to bottom in a series of shows across the country, including three shows (10/31, 11/1, two on 11/2) at N.Y.’s City Winery. He’ll also sample from his latest album, the boldly experimental yet deeply personal Modern Art, which hits next Tuesday (9/27) on Orchard-distribbed Missing Piece. You can stream the album on Rdio, and in a way-cool move, it’s also streaming with Matthew’s commentary. Additionally, a live acoustic sampler containing three classics plus a version of Byrds-y new single “She Walks the Night” is downloadable for free from Noisetrade. (9/23a)
